The shear pressure at any section on the cantilever beam is the sum in the masses concerning the absolutely free end as well as the part. The bending instant in a offered segment on the cantilever could be the sum of the moments acting within the area from all masses involving the free end website and also the segment.

, and theater balconies could be also. A cantilevered bridge may have a big span (providing here 1,800 toes) created out on either facet of an individual large Basis pier. Architects at times use cantilevered construction to make remarkable consequences; Frank Lloyd Wright's "Fallingwater" residence, which extends out around a rocky river, can be a well-known illustration.
